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
vbzoom version 1.11
Description
The issue all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ML, which can lead to mult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ities. This is achieved by injecting malicious input via the
UserID parameter to specific API endpoints, such as "comment.php" or "contact.php".Recommendations
For vbzoom version 1.11, consider restricting access to the
comment.php and contact.php endpoints until a fix is available, and avoid using the UserID parameter in these endpoints to minimize the risk of exploitation.Exploit
